Seamus Gilmartin of the Harvard University football team has been recently arrested, but that’s not the main part.

The football tight end of the Harvard University team was arrested alongside viral sorority girl Lily Stewart from the University of Georgia.

Stewart and Gilmartin, along with two other students, were involved in a late-night incident on campus. The arrest occurred around 3 AM on a Sunday when police responded to an intrusion alarm triggered at the University of Georgia student center, which is closed after midnight.

Upon noticing the police, Gilmartin and Stewart, along with two others, attempted to escape but were apprehended shortly after the officers approached the building.

According to TMZ, Gilmartin possessed two fraudulent IDs, one from New York and another from California, during the arrest, which resulted in additional charges. He was charged with underage possession of alcohol, loitering/prowling, and possession of a fraudulent ID.

Consequently, he has been barred from returning to the University of Georgia campus for a period of two years.
